Market Overview
The Global Generic Drugs Market was valued at $411.99 Billion in 2022 and is projected to reach $613.34 Billion by 2030. The market is expected to grow at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.10% during the forecast period.
The Global Generic Drugs Market is expected to experience significant growth between 2024 and 2035. As patents for blockbuster drugs expire and healthcare costs continue to rise, generic drugs have gained a pivotal role in the global pharmaceutical industry. Generic drugs are bioequivalent to their branded counterparts in terms of dosage, strength, route of administration, quality, and intended use, but they are sold at a fraction of the price.
Generic drugs account for a substantial portion of the global drug market due to their cost-effectiveness, making them increasingly popular with consumers, healthcare providers, and governments seeking to reduce overall medical expenditure. These drugs play a vital role in improving healthcare accessibility, as they allow patients to access high-quality medication at more affordable rates.

Product Types
The market encompasses various types of generic medications, including but not limited to:
- Generic Prescription Drugs: These are the most common types of generic drugs, representing medications available only through a prescription, such as antibiotics, painkillers, and anti-hypertensives.
- Over-the-Counter (OTC) Generic Drugs: These include non-prescription medications like cold and flu treatments, allergy relief, and digestive aids.
- Biologics and Biosimilars: Generic versions of biologic drugs, known as biosimilars, have emerged as a key growth area in the pharmaceutical industry. Biosimilars are almost identical to their reference biologic products and are expected to revolutionize the treatment of conditions such as cancer, autoimmune diseases, and diabetes.
Key Characteristics of Generic Drugs
- Bioequivalence: Generic drugs are required to have the same active ingredient and therapeutic effect as the branded drug.
- Cost-Effectiveness: One of the most significant factors driving the generic drug market is their affordability. Generic drugs are typically 80-85% cheaper than their brand-name counterparts.
- Safety and Quality Assurance: Generic drugs undergo rigorous testing to meet the same safety standards as their branded versions. Regulatory bodies such as the FDA ensure that generics are as safe and effective as the original.
Primary Uses
Generic drugs are used to treat a wide variety of medical conditions, including chronic diseases such as diabetes, heart disease, hypertension, and cancer. These drugs are available for both acute conditions (like infections) and long-term care.

Competitive Landscape: Key Market Players and Strategies
The generic drugs market is highly competitive, with several players vying for market share. Key pharmaceutical companies that dominate the global market include:
- Teva Pharmaceutical Industries Ltd.: A global leader in generic medicines, Teva offers a wide range of generic prescription drugs and biosimilars. The company is also expanding its presence in emerging markets.
- Sandoz (Novartis): A leader in generic pharmaceuticals and biosimilars, Sandoz is committed to providing high-quality generic medications across a broad spectrum of therapeutic areas.
- Mylan (now part of Viatris): Mylan is one of the largest players in the generic drugs industry, with a focus on both oral and injectable generic products. The company's acquisition by Viatris has strengthened its market position.
- Amgen: Known for its biosimilars, Amgen is expanding its generic offerings, especially in the oncology and immunology sectors.
Strategies Adopted by Key Players
- Strategic Mergers and Acquisitions: Pharmaceutical companies are increasingly engaging in mergers and acquisitions to expand their product portfolios and geographic reach. For instance, Viatris' merger with Mylan has made it one of the top players in the generic drugs market.
- R&D Investments: Leading players are investing heavily in research and development to produce high-quality generics, particularly in high-demand therapeutic areas such as oncology and neurology.
- Geographic Expansion: Companies are focusing on expanding their reach in emerging markets like Asia-Pacific and Africa, where access to affordable medications is a growing concern.

Pricing Trends: Cost Dynamics in the Generic Drugs Market
Pricing is a key factor in the growth of the generic drugs market. The cost of generics is significantly lower than branded drugs, primarily due to the lack of R&D costs and shorter production timelines. Pricing trends are affected by various factors:
- Patent Expirations: The expiration of patents for popular branded drugs opens up opportunities for generics to enter the market at lower prices.
- Regulatory Policies: In regions like the U.S. and Europe, regulatory frameworks that encourage the use of generics help keep prices competitive.
- Competition: Increased competition from multiple generic manufacturers helps drive prices down, benefiting consumers.
